Role Overview: This position is for an experienced Electrician working across utility‑scale solar farms, BESS sites, ICP works and ground‑mount O&M projects. You’ll take a leading role on site, overseeing labourers and mates, ensuring safe, compliant and high‑quality electrical installation and maintenance across major renewable energy projects. This role suits someone who enjoys large‑scale infrastructure, can take ownership on site, and wants long‑term progression within a growing, forward‑thinking organisation.
Key Responsibilities
- Installation & Construction
- Install electrical systems including cabling, containment, trenching, terminations and LV equipment.
- Work on power stations, substations, solar arrays, BESS sites and ICP connection activities.
- Carry out LV testing and support HV teams where required.
- Technical & Compliance
- Read and interpret schematics, drawings and engineering plans.
- Ensure all work meets BS7671, safety standards and project specifications.
- Maintain accurate documentation of works, materials and safety compliance.
- Leadership & Team Coordination
- Lead a small team of Electrician Mates and Labourers on site.
- Provide training, guidance and feedback to support their development.
- Act as site lead when required, liaising with Site Management and Project Management.
- Communication & Collaboration
- Work closely with project teams to ensure smooth delivery.
- Represent the organisation professionally with clients and contractors.
Person Specification
- Essential
- Level 2/3 City & Guilds in Electrical Installation or Electrical Engineering.
- Experience in utility‑scale solar, BESS, or LV/HV construction.
- Strong understanding of central/string inverters.
- Ability to interpret electrical drawings and schematics.
- Knowledge of earthing systems and current H&S legislation.
- Full UK driving licence.
- Strong communication, safety awareness, problem‑solving and time‑management skills.
- Desirable
- 17th/18th Edition (BS7671).
- HV experience (training can be provided).
- AP15 / OP40 certification.
- SSSTS or IOSH Managing Safely.
Progression Opportunity for LV Authorisation / AP progression for the right candidate.
